Salem Seasonality

cleaning services seasonality in Salem: a month-by-month calendar

cleaning services demand in Salem runs through the year rather than in one season; temperatures peak in August (average high 84°F) and bottom out in December (average low 35°F), so weather affects scheduling more than demand. The figures below are NOAA 1991-2020 monthly normals for SALEM MCNARY FLD, about 5 miles from Salem; read them with the Salem market page, the cleaning services industry page, smart scheduling and the AI receptionist in mind.

Demand for cleaning services in Salem is spread across the year, so weather affects scheduling and routing more than it affects whether the work exists.

Across the whole year, Salem's average high peaks at 84°F in August and its average low bottoms out at 35°F in December; precipitation is highest in December (7.0 inches) and lowest in July (0.3 inches).

Seasonality changes staffing and cash flow more than it changes whether the work exists. Planning capacity around the busy months, and using the quieter ones for recurring-service sign-ups and follow-up, is the standard way cleaning services businesses smooth the year.

  • January: 48°F high / 36°F low, 6.1 in of precipitation
  • February: 52°F high / 36°F low, 4.5 in of precipitation, 0.8 in of snow
  • March: 57°F high / 38°F low, 4.3 in of precipitation
  • April: 62°F high / 41°F low, 3.1 in of precipitation
  • May: 69°F high / 46°F low, 2.3 in of precipitation
  • June: 75°F high / 51°F low, 1.3 in of precipitation
  • July: 84°F high / 55°F low, 0.3 in of precipitation
  • August: 84°F high / 55°F low, 0.4 in of precipitation
  • September: 78°F high / 51°F low, 1.5 in of precipitation
  • October: 65°F high / 44°F low, 3.5 in of precipitation
  • November: 54°F high / 39°F low, 6.0 in of precipitation
  • December: 47°F high / 35°F low, 7.0 in of precipitation

How does the CRM handle clients who switch between weekly and biweekly cleaning?+

The system makes frequency changes seamless. When a client requests a switch from weekly to biweekly, the system updates their recurring schedule, adjusts pricing automatically if you offer frequency-based discounts, and reallocates the freed time slots to your waitlist or availability pool. The cleaner assigned to that client sees the updated schedule instantly on their mobile app. The system also keeps a log of frequency changes so you can identify clients who may be scaling back before eventually canceling.

Can I manage both residential and commercial cleaning clients in the same system?+

Yes. The system supports multiple service types with separate pricing structures, scheduling rules, and communication templates. Commercial clients can be tagged separately and assigned to different teams or time slots — for example, office cleanings scheduled for evenings or weekends. Reporting can be filtered by client type so you can track residential and commercial revenue independently. Many cleaning companies find that commercial contracts provide stable baseline revenue while residential clients offer higher margins.
